Need to fill a vacancy with a relevant candidate really quickly? Fill out the form and we will contact you today

Leave a request

Senior Automation QA Engineer (Python)

Evotalents
Evotalents
Admin

Location:

Lviv, Ukraine | Remote, Ukraine

Scalr is seeking a Senior Automation QA, creative thinker who loves to be on the cutting edge and to solve problems through technology.

Scalr is a remote state & operations backend for Terraform™ with full CLI support, integration with OPA, a hierarchical configuration model, and quality of life features.

By joining our team, you’ll face the challenges and tradeoffs of building a highly reliable production system composed of modern microservices and the previous monolithic approach. The principal stack is Python, MySQL, RabbitMQ, Docker, and many python libraries for different problem domains: cloud, networking, data, concurrency, parsers, etc.

Our expectations

  • 3+ years of Python programming
  • Good knowledge of test frameworks: Pytest, Selenium/Playwright, Postman
  • Understanding API, REST
  • Basic knowledge of Linux
  • Good understanding Docker, containers, and how work operating systems
  • Experience in manual testing

Would be nice to have

  • DevOps experience (one from Terraform, Chef, Ansible, SaltStack, etc.)
  • Knowledge of network protocols (TCP/IP stack, sockets, HTTP/HTTPS, etc.)
  • Hands-on experience in full-stack web development (ReactJS)
  • Kubernetes basic knowledge

What Will You Do

  • Closely collaborating with backend/frontend engineers, product designers and support
  • Working with a release engineer to certify release readiness
  • Planning and implementing test cases of all types: e2e, functional, load, chaos
  • Be responsible for test pyramid performance, stability, and maintainability
  • Improving QA automation tools and practices

Challenges you’ll need to meet

  • Each task is unique and will require immersion in the subject
  • Studying of third-party services API, studying of Terraform behavior, design of internal services
  • Integrate modern techniques and libraries into tests

What we offer

  • Work with interesting product in an enjoyable environment
  • The opportunity to see how your ideas and visions are realized
  • Attractive compensation and benefits package
  • Long-term contract and tax compensations
  • Remote work or in the office
  • 20 working days of paid vacation and unlimited paid sick leaves